4/9/2025Bangalore, popularly known as the Silicon Valley of India, is undergoing a significant transformation in its real estate sector. The city is witnessing a growing trend towards sustainable residential projects, a shift fueled by increasing environmental awareness, rapid urbanization, and changing preferences among homebuyers. Green living, once considered niche, is now at the forefront of modern housing developments in Bangalore.
Developers have started prioritizing eco-friendly homes that minimize environmental impact while maximizing comfort for residents. These sustainable projects in Bangalore are characterized by the use of renewable energy sources such as solar panels, rainwater harvesting systems, and energy-efficient lighting. By integrating these features, builders are not only reducing the carbon footprint but also lowering utility costs for homeowners.
One can notice a surge in demand for green buildings and energy-efficient apartments, especially in areas like Whitefield, Sarjapur Road, and Electronic City. Homebuyers and investors are searching for residential projects that offer a blend of modern amenities and sustainability. Features like rooftop gardens, efficient waste management systems, and sustainable building materials are no longer optional—they are becoming integral to new housing projects in Bangalore.

The government of Karnataka and local authorities are also playing an active role by introducing incentives for sustainable construction and enforcing eco-friendly building standards. This has encouraged more builders to focus on environmentally conscious designs and practices. As a result, there is a noticeable increase in LEED-certified and IGBC-rated residential projects, which further boosts buyer confidence in the quality and sustainability of these developments.
For families, sustainable homes mean healthier living environments. Improved air quality, natural lighting, and green spaces contribute to overall well-being. In addition, residents appreciate the long-term savings that come with energy-efficient appliances and water conservation techniques. Many new projects now feature community gardens, walking tracks, and dedicated spaces for urban farming, making eco-friendly lifestyles accessible to city dwellers.
The trend towards sustainable residential projects in Bangalore is also attracting millennials and young professionals who value both environmental responsibility and smart investments. With growing concerns about climate change and resource depletion, these buyers are actively searching for homes that align with their values. The rise of smart homes equipped with automation systems, energy monitoring, and sustainable interiors is further elevating the standard of living in the city.
